Etymology

[edit]

нави́вам (navívam, to wind, to coil) +‎ -ач (-ač)

Pronunciation

[edit]

Noun

[edit]

навива́ч (naviváčm (feminine навива́чка)

  1. one who winds or coils up
  2. (figuratively) cheerer, agitator

Etymology

[edit]

From навива (naviva) +‎ -ач (-ač).

Pronunciation

[edit]

Noun

[edit]

навивач (navivačm (plural навивачи, feminine навивачка, relational adjective навивачки, augmentative навивачиште)

  1. fan, cheerer
